首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

模拟presentViewController缓动的UIView动画

是指在iOS开发中,通过使用UIView动画来模拟presentViewController的缓动效果。这种动画效果可以增加用户界面的交互性和吸引力。

在iOS开发中,可以使用UIView的动画方法来实现这个效果。具体步骤如下:

  1. 创建一个新的UIViewController,作为要present的视图控制器。
  2. 在当前视图控制器中,使用UIView的animateWithDuration方法来执行动画。该方法可以指定动画的持续时间、动画选项以及动画的具体实现。
  3. 在动画的block中,设置要present的视图控制器的初始位置和最终位置。可以通过修改视图控制器的frame或transform属性来实现位置的变化。
  4. 在动画的block中,设置要present的视图控制器的透明度。可以通过修改视图控制器的alpha属性来实现透明度的变化。
  5. 在动画的block中,调用presentViewController方法来实现视图控制器的present效果。
  6. 在动画的completion block中,可以处理动画结束后的逻辑,例如执行其他操作或者添加其他动画效果。

这种模拟presentViewController缓动的UIView动画可以应用于各种场景,例如在应用程序启动时展示欢迎界面、在用户点击某个按钮后展示新的视图控制器等。

腾讯云相关产品中,可以使用腾讯云移动推送(https://cloud.tencent.com/product/tpns)来实现推送通知,提醒用户进行操作。此外,腾讯云还提供了丰富的云计算产品,如云服务器、云数据库、云存储等,可以满足各种应用场景的需求。

注意:以上答案仅供参考,具体的实现方式和推荐的产品可能会根据具体需求和技术选型而有所不同。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分4秒

动画效果如何快速实现?研发神器PAG,消除动效研发成本,释放设计生产力!

领券